Abstract
An electrophotographic member has an electro-conductive substrate, an elastic layer on the substrate and a coating layer on the elastic layer. The elastic layer has an elastic modulus of 0.5 MPa to 3.0 MPa and the coating layer has an elastic modulus of 5.0 MPa to 100.0 MPa as measured in an environment of a temperature of 30° C. and a relative humidity of 80%.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An electrophotographic member comprising an electro-conductive substrate, an elastic layer on the substrate and a coating layer on the elastic layer, wherein
the elastic layer has a first protrusion on a surface thereof on a side opposite to a side facing the substrate,
the electrophotographic member has, on an outer surface thereof, a second protrusion derived from the first protrusion,
the outer surface of the electrophotographic member has one or more of electrical insulating first region(s) and an electro-conductive second region,
the elastic layer has an elastic modulus, as measured in an environment of a temperature of 30° C. and a relative humidity of 80%, of 0.5 MPa or more to 3.0 MPa or less and
the coating layer has an elastic modulus, as measured in an environment of a temperature of 30° C. and a relative humidity of 80%, of 5.0 MPa or more to 100.0 MPa or less.
2. The electrophotographic member according to claim 1 , wherein the first region has an electrical insulating part on a surface of the coating layer on a side opposite to a side facing the substrate.
3. The electrophotographic member according to claim 2 , wherein the electrical insulating part contains a resin.
4. The electrophotographic member according to claim 2 , wherein the electrical insulating part has an elastic modulus larger than the elastic modulus of the coating layer.
5. The electrophotographic member according to claim 1 , wherein the coating layer is an electro-conductive and the second region has a portion of a surface of the coating layer on a side opposite to a side facing the substrate.
6. The electrophotographic member according to claim 5 , wherein the coating layer has a volume resistivity of from 1×10 5 to 1×10 11 Ω·cm.
7. The electrophotographic member according to claim 2 , wherein the electrical insulating part has a volume resistivity of from 1×10 13 to 1×10 18 Ω·cm.
8. The electrophotographic member according to claim 1 , further comprising an electro-conductive surface layer on a surface of the coating layer on a side opposite to a side facing the substrate, wherein:
the surface layer comprises, on a surface thereof on a side opposite to a side facing the coating layer, an electrical insulating region and an electro-conductive region,
the electrical insulating region constitutes the first region and
the electro-conductive region constitutes the second region.
9. The electrophotographic member according to claim 8 , wherein the electrical insulating region has an elastic modulus larger than the elastic modulus of the coating layer.
10. The electrophotographic member according to claim 8 , wherein the surface layer has an electrical insulating part constituting the first region and an electro-conductive part constituting the second region.
11. The electrophotographic member according to claim 10 , wherein the electrical insulating part has a volume resistivity of from 1×10 13 to 1×10 18 Ω·cm.
12. The electrophotographic member according to claim 10 , wherein the electro-conductive part has a volume resistivity of from 1×10 5 to 1×10 11 Ω·cm.
13. The electrophotographic member according to claim 1 , wherein when a surface of the electrical insulating first region constituting the outer surface of the electrophotographic member is charged to a potential V0 (V), a potential damping time constant defined as a time required for damping the surface potential to V0×(1/e) is 60 seconds or more.
14. The electrophotographic member according to claim 1 , wherein when a surface of the electro-conductive second region constituting the outer surface of the electrophotographic member is charged to a potential V0 (V), a potential damping time constant defined as a time required for damping the surface potential to V0×(1/e) is less than 6.0 seconds.
